我的编程空间,编程开发者的网络收藏夹
学习永远不晚

管理SQL拼接的策略是什么

短信预约 -IT技能 免费直播动态提醒
省份

北京

  • 北京
  • 上海
  • 天津
  • 重庆
  • 河北
  • 山东
  • 辽宁
  • 黑龙江
  • 吉林
  • 甘肃
  • 青海
  • 河南
  • 江苏
  • 湖北
  • 湖南
  • 江西
  • 浙江
  • 广东
  • 云南
  • 福建
  • 海南
  • 山西
  • 四川
  • 陕西
  • 贵州
  • 安徽
  • 广西
  • 内蒙
  • 西藏
  • 新疆
  • 宁夏
  • 兵团
手机号立即预约

请填写图片验证码后获取短信验证码

看不清楚,换张图片

免费获取短信验证码

管理SQL拼接的策略是什么

管理SQL拼接的策略包括以下几个方面:

  1. 使用参数化查询:尽量避免直接拼接SQL语句,而是使用参数化查询,将参数传递给数据库引擎,可以有效防止SQL注入攻击。

  2. 使用ORM框架:ORM(Object-Relational Mapping)框架可以帮助开发人员将对象模型和数据库表映射起来,避免手动拼接SQL语句,减少错误和提高开发效率。

  3. 避免动态拼接SQL:尽量避免在代码中动态拼接SQL语句,可以考虑使用存储过程或者视图来封装复杂的查询逻辑。

  4. 使用工具辅助:可以使用一些SQL编辑工具或者ORM框架来辅助管理SQL拼接,提高开发效率和代码质量。

  5. 定期审查和优化:定期审查和优化已有的SQL拼接逻辑,确保查询效率和安全性,避免潜在的性能问题和安全漏洞。

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

管理SQL拼接的策略是什么

下载Word文档到电脑,方便收藏和打印~

下载Word文档

猜你喜欢

管理SQL拼接的策略是什么

管理SQL拼接的策略包括以下几个方面:使用参数化查询:尽量避免直接拼接SQL语句,而是使用参数化查询,将参数传递给数据库引擎,可以有效防止SQL注入攻击。使用ORM框架:ORM(Object-Relational Mapping)框架可以帮
管理SQL拼接的策略是什么
2024-04-29

SQLite中SQL的拼接策略是什么

在SQLite中,SQL的拼接通常是通过使用字符串连接运算符||来实现的。通过将字符串或列名用||运算符连接起来,可以将它们拼接成一个完整的SQL语句。例如:SELECT column1 || ' ' || colum
SQLite中SQL的拼接策略是什么
2024-04-29

微服务架构下的SQL拼接策略是什么

在微服务架构下,SQL拼接策略通常会根据具体的需求和情况来选择合适的方式。以下是一些常见的SQL拼接策略:使用ORM框架:ORM(对象关系映射)框架可以将数据库表和对象之间的映射关系封装起来,开发者可以通过操作对象来实现对数据库的操作,而不
微服务架构下的SQL拼接策略是什么
2024-04-29

Git分支管理的策略是什么

这篇“Git分支管理的策略是什么”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这篇“Git分支管理的策略是什么”文章吧。一、创建测
2023-06-29

SQL拼接与数据库权限管理的方法是什么

SQL拼接是指在SQL语句中通过连接字符拼接多个字符串或表达式,常用于动态生成SQL语句的情况。在SQL中,可以使用拼接符号(如“+”、“||”等)将多个字符串或表达式连接在一起。例如,在查询中,可以通过拼接来动态生成条件语句:DECL
SQL拼接与数据库权限管理的方法是什么
2024-04-29

PL/SQL中的SQL注入防范策略是什么

在PL/SQL中,防范SQL注入的策略主要包括以下几点:使用绑定变量:通过使用绑定变量来传递参数,而不是直接将参数拼接到SQL语句中,可以有效防止SQL注入攻击。绑定变量可以在SQL语句中使用冒号(:)来表示,然后通过绑定参数的方式传递变量
PL/SQL中的SQL注入防范策略是什么
2024-05-08

Python中SQL拼接的方法是什么

在Python中,我们可以通过使用字符串拼接的方式来构建SQL语句。例如,可以使用字符串变量来表示SQL语句的不同部分,然后通过字符串拼接的方式将它们组合在一起。另外,还可以使用format()方法来将变量插入SQL语句中。下面是一个简单的
Python中SQL拼接的方法是什么
2024-04-29

SQL拼接的基本概念是什么

SQL拼接是指通过特定的语法将多个字符串或表达式连接在一起形成一个新的字符串或表达式的操作。在SQL中,拼接通常使用特定的操作符(如“+”、“CONCAT”等)来实现,从而可以将不同的数据串联在一起,以便在查询中使用。拼接在SQL中常用于构
SQL拼接的基本概念是什么
2024-04-29

sql两张表拼接的方法是什么

在 SQL 中,可以使用 UNION 操作符将两张表进行拼接。UNION 操作符用于将两个或多个 SELECT 语句的结果集合并为一个结果集。以下是一个示例:SELECT column1, column2FROM table1UNIO
sql两张表拼接的方法是什么
2024-05-06

Golang高并发场景中的锁管理策略是什么?

锁管理策略提升 golang 高并发性能锁类型: 互斥锁(mutex),读写锁(rwmutex),原子操作最佳实践:最小化锁的粒度避免死锁使用读写锁使用原子操作实战案例: 使用互斥锁保护银行账户余额的修改操作性能优化:使用 sync.poo
Golang高并发场景中的锁管理策略是什么?
2024-05-10

sql字符串拼接的方法是什么

在SQL中,字符串拼接可以使用 CONCAT() 函数来实现。例如,如果我们想要将两个字符串拼接在一起,可以使用以下语法:SELECT CONCAT('Hello ', 'World') AS co
sql字符串拼接的方法是什么
2024-04-09

sql字段拼接查询的方法是什么

在 SQL 中,可以使用 CONCAT 函数来拼接字段查询。例如,假设有两个字段 first_name 和 last_name,要将它们拼接为一个名字字段,可以使用以下 SQL 查询语句:SELECT CONCAT(first_name,
sql字段拼接查询的方法是什么
2024-03-04

MyBatis中动态SQL拼接的方法是什么

MyBatis中动态SQL拼接的方法主要是使用if、choose、when、otherwise等标签来实现动态条件拼接。具体来说,可以在mapper.xml文件中使用这些标签来根据条件动态生成SQL语句。例如: